The Case Management Program of Nazhoen Lamtoen, supported provides vital protection and rehabilitation services for children in difficult circumstances (CIDC) and children in conflict with the law (CICL) across Bhutan. Operating through a referral-based system, cases are received from diverse stakeholders including the Royal Bhutan Police, PEMA Secretariat, RENEW Centres, schools, and community leaders. Each case undergoes systematic assessment, followed by tailored intervention across six phases: identification, assessment, planning, implementation, monitoring, and case closure.
Between 2023 and 2024 in Thimphu Dzongkhag, the program delivered interventions exceeding Nu. 373,570, spanning disability support, domestic violence, mental health, educational assistance, livelihood training, and rehabilitation for CICL. Highlights include support for disabled siblings at Draktsho, scholastic support for children from impoverished households, training sponsorships for teen mothers, and vocational rehabilitation for a 16-year-old CICL case. Many interventions extended beyond material aid, empowering parents and guardians through skill development and sustainable livelihood opportunities.
The report emphasizes the growing funding challenges due to shifting donor priorities, urging continued support to ensure that vulnerable children are not deprioritized. By combining compassion with coordinated action, Nazhoen Lamtoen works to restore dignity, resilience, and hope for children and families most at risk.
